    When AI can generate harmony, structure, texture, even emotion—
    “good” becomes a technical standard,
    and technical standards are no longer rare.

    So the question shifts.

    I’m no longer interested in whether a song is well-made.
    I care about whether it can be lived in.

    A song is not something to judge.
    It is a space to enter.

    You don’t understand a song because you analyzed it.
    You understand it because, at some point,
    you became the person inside it.

    That’s why some music feels empty, even when it’s perfect.
    And some feels overwhelming, even when it’s simple.

    It’s not about complexity.
    It’s about alignment.

    AI can generate sound.
    But it cannot live a life.

    It cannot arrive at a moment
    where a single tone carries the weight of memory,
    or where silence means more than composition.

    So I’m not trying to compete with AI.
    I’m trying to build worlds that require a human to exist.

    Music, for me, is no longer an object.
    It is a condition of being.

    And creating is not about proving what is right—
    but about staying close
    to what has not yet been said.

Inner War (Rough Mix)

Silvan Tang: Producer, Composer, Arrange, Lyrics, Vocal

Genre: Melodic EDM

Song Theme: A psychological descent into the inner world, where perception begins to construct reality and the self becomes both witness and battlefield. What originates as an internal unrest slowly manifests outward, blurring the line between imagined fear and external truth. The piece explores how identity fractures under pressure, questioning whether the conflict we experience belongs to the world itself—or is merely a projection shaped by memory, instinct, and doubt. In this space, the war is never with others, but with the shifting, unresolved self.

The Parallel Songs

Silvan Tang: Producer, Composer, Arrange, Lyrics, Vocal, Mix

Genre: Electronic Pop / Afro Pop

Song Theme:A nostalgic and spatial reflection on friendship, time, and shared existence, tracing parallel emotional paths across years of connection. The piece captures fragments of lived moments—travel, distance, laughter, and stillness—interwoven into a single sonic memory. Set against landscapes like New York, Los Angeles, and Hawaii, it preserves a sense of presence that continues to echo beyond time and place. At its core, it is about the simultaneity of lives once closely aligned, and the quiet hope that connection, once formed, continues to exist in parallel.
